John Ray Derosin, aged 58, of New Roads, LA, passed away on September 26, 2025, in New Orleans, LA. He was born on July 23, 1967, at Sisters of St. Joseph Hospital in New Roads, LA to Richard and Mary Battley Derosin. John was a beloved son, brother, father, uncle, cousin and friend.
John graduated from Rosenwald High School in 1985 and later attended the University of New Orleans. John enjoyed fishing with his cousins whenever he had the opportunity, and he lit up every time he spoke about fishing. John Ray was also interested in digital investments and loved watching football and taking vacations with his family whenever he could.
John was married to Yeshiva Ambrose and from that union one daughter was born. He's survived by his daughter, Kennedy Rae Derosin, New Orleans, LA, his parents, Mary and Richard Derosin, Jr. (New Roads, LA), one sister, Cynthia Derosin-Butler (Robert Butler) of Robert, LA, one niece Cyan Butler of (Robert, LA), two nephews Shawn Butler of (Illinois) and Joshua Butler of (Missouri). He was preceded in death by his maternal grandparents, Enest and Cecelia Victorian Battley and paternal grandparents, Richard and Velma Smith Derosin.
John will be deeply missed, but his memory will forever live in the hearts of those who loved him. He will be remembered for his kindness and sense of humor, dedication, and generosity. Friends and family knew him as someone who always had a story to tell and was the first to lend a hand.
Above all, John will be remembered for the love he gave, the joy he brought, and the legacy of faith, family, and hard work that will continue to inspire all who knew him.
